
The IETI Romanian Society convened a hybrid (online-offline) meeting at the Romanian-American University, Romania, on March 27.
During the event, Prof. Yongji Guo, Co-Founder of the Romanian Society and representative of the International Engineering and Technology Institute (IETI) and the International Research Institute for Economic Management (IRIEM), presented awards and certificates to outstanding team members.
